Transaction fdac85188454e168fcd280d18982d934c209f8ec3c63a6a372a4ace841127356
1 Input
1 Output
-
fdac85188454e168fcd280d18982d934c209f8ec3c63a6a372a4ace841127356:0
- value
- 1503754
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c30e7f4d7565266f05546f8a1112b7f24269160
- address
- bc1qescw0axh2efxduz4gmu2zyft0ujzdytqyl8zea